Where does “nervoza” come from?

nervoza (Serbo-Croatian) comes from Serbo-Croatian -oza, from Ancient Greek -ωσις, from Ancient Greek -σῐς, from Ancient Greek -τις, from Proto-Indo-European -tis — Derives abstract/action nouns from verb roots.

nervoza (Serbo-Croatian): nervousness
